Is there a lower age limited to join UKCM?

Author:  Pug50 [ Wed Jan 28, 2015 12:06 pm ]
Post subject: 

Nope, but the rules & regs (READ HERE) includes:
Quote:
Members Under 18 years of age.

UKCM accepts members under the age of 18, however they must be accompanied by a Parent and/or Guardian at all times.


And, as you experienced at the Christmas do, it's up to the parent to decide how much of the UKCM experience is suitable for their kids ... :D
